John-Zink - Model COOLstar -Process Burner
The COOLstar Burner from John Zink is designed for ultra-low NOx gas firing applications and delivers stable flames and NOx emissions as low as 15 ppm.

The COOLstar® Burner represents the latest advancement in ultra-low NOx combustion technology. Engineered with a proprietary tile design and integrated Coanda surface, it achieves superior fuel-flue gas mixing and flame stability. This burner is versatile, capable of handling various fuel compositions such as natural gas and hydrogen blends, and is suitable for a range of applications, from refining to ethylene production. Extensive testing and field applications have demonstrated its reliability, low emissions, and efficient performance.
- Innovative Tile Design: Divided into primary and staged segments for improved mixing and larger flame surface area.
- Coanda Surface: Integrated to enhance stability and mixing.
- Hydrogen-Ready: Designed to operate efficiently with hydrogen or hydrogen-blended fuels, supporting the transition to cleaner energy and future-proofing your operations.
- Proprietary ARIA™ Register: Ensures optimal air distribution and control.
- Wide Turndown Ratio: Capable of operating efficiently across a broad range of conditions.
- Low CO Emissions: Achieves near-zero CO emissions under normal operating conditions.
- Ultra-Low NOx Emissions: Achieves NOx emissions as low as 15 ppm.
- High Efficiency: Enhanced mixing and stability lead to superior combustion efficiency.
- Versatility: Suitable for various fuels, including hydrogen blends and natural gas.
- Compact Design: Small footprint makes it ideal for new installations and revamps.
- Reliability: Proven performance in more than 50,000 installations worldwide.
